Core Skills Analysis

Science

  • Understanding the properties of materials: The student explored the textures and properties of kinetic sand, observing its flow and how it can hold shapes.
  • Experimenting with mixing: The student may have experimented with combining kinetic sand with other materials, learning about mixtures and their properties.
  • Cause and effect: Through manipulating the sand, the student learned about how force and motion affect the sand's behavior.
  • Observation skills: The activity encouraged the student to observe closely how different formations are created by applying different pressures.

Mathematics

  • Measurement: The student may have measured quantities of kinetic sand to create specific shapes, enhancing their understanding of volume.
  • Symmetry and shapes: Creating structures with kinetic sand provided a practical application for learning about shapes, symmetry, and geometry.
  • Estimation: The student practiced estimating how much sand was needed for various projects, which ties into addition and subtraction skills.
  • Patterns: While shaping the sand, the student could explore patterns and sequences through the repetition of actions and designs.

Art

  • Creativity: The activity encourages imaginative thinking as the student creates statues, landscapes, or abstract figures.
  • Fine motor skills: Manipulating the kinetic sand helps develop f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ination.
  • Color mixing: If colored kinetic sand is used, the student learns about color theory and mixing colors.
  • Design principles: The student can apply principles of design, such as balance and contrast, when creating their sculptures.

Tips

To further explore kinetic sand, students could experiment with adding different elements such as water or color to see how it changes the properties. They might also challenge themselves to create specific structures or sculptures inspired by real-world objects. Improvement can take place in refining their fine motor skills and experimenting with larger creations that require more stability.
